Mistake proofing. Learn Zero Defect Quality System (ZDQ). The TRIZ Approach. The true brilliance of this mistake proofing methodology is in its simplicity.





These often cheap and effective solutions can be integrated into the product design or in one of the process steps.

Poka yoke is a Japanese phrase that translates to error prevention. A “poka” is an “unintentional error,” and “yokeru” is Japanese for “preventing.”
